深圳市科技有限公司

科技 ·
首页 / 资讯 / 企业搜索数据库索引:常见结构类型解析

企业搜索数据库索引:常见结构类型解析

企业搜索数据库索引:常见结构类型解析

企业搜索数据库索引:常见结构类型解析

一、索引概述

在信息化时代,企业对数据的处理和分析能力日益增强,而数据库索引作为提高查询效率的关键技术,其重要性不言而喻。本文将解析企业搜索数据库中常见的索引结构类型,帮助读者深入了解其原理和应用。

二、B树索引

B树索引是一种自平衡的树形结构,能够有效地组织数据,并支持快速的数据检索。其特点如下:

1. 数据有序:B树索引中,数据按照一定的顺序排列,便于快速查找。 2. 自平衡:当插入或删除节点时,B树会自动调整,保持平衡。 3. 分层存储:B树索引采用分层存储结构,便于快速定位数据。

三、哈希索引

哈希索引通过哈希函数将数据映射到索引表中,具有以下特点:

1. 查询速度快:哈希索引的查询速度通常比B树索引更快,因为其直接通过哈希值定位数据。 2. 不支持排序:哈希索引不支持数据的有序存储,因此无法进行排序操作。

四、全文索引

全文索引适用于文本数据的搜索,能够对文本内容进行分词、索引和搜索。其特点如下:

1. 高效搜索:全文索引能够快速定位文本中的关键词,提高搜索效率。 2. 支持多种搜索方式:全文索引支持多种搜索方式,如精确匹配、模糊匹配等。

五、倒排索引

倒排索引是一种反向索引结构,将文档中的关键词映射到对应的文档位置。其特点如下:

1. 快速检索:倒排索引能够快速定位关键词在文档中的位置,提高检索速度。 2. 支持多种搜索:倒排索引支持多种搜索方式,如关键词搜索、短语搜索等。

六、总结

企业搜索数据库索引结构类型繁多,每种索引都有其独特的应用场景。了解不同索引的特点和适用场景,有助于提高数据库查询效率,满足企业对数据检索的需求。在实际应用中,应根据具体业务需求选择合适的索引结构。

本文由 深圳市科技有限公司 整理发布。

更多科技文章

定制智慧解决方案,关键在于精准匹配需求SaaS平台定制开发:揭秘高效流程的五大步骤医疗SaaS平台用户体验优化的关键要素腾讯云机器学习平台与华为云ModelArts:架构解析与功能对比企业数据治理实施步骤:从规划到落地的全流程解析上海科技企业年检流程详解:关键步骤与注意事项ERP软件实施费用包含实施周期吗电商行业云原生故障排查:实战经验与策略解析API网关跨域配置:揭秘高效跨域数据交互之道电商行业大数据分析框架:构建高效决策的基石**Apache Hadoop数据仓库架构设计的核心考量**信息化建设中的关键参数:数字化转型的核心考量**
友情链接: 浙江电子科技有限公司山东技术有限公司郑州管道设备有限公司luoxuanbaohutao.com上海实业有限公司广告有限公司武陟县服务有限公司凯瑞广告有限公司东莞市机械有限公司深圳实业有限公司